Former Conservative minister Lord Offord has been named as Reform UK's Scottish leader. The ex-Scottish Tory treasurer was unveiled by party leader Nigel Farage at an event in Fife. He will lead the party into May's Scottish Parliament election, with Reform aiming to make a major electoral breakthrough north of the border.
